Libconfig

一:什麼是Libconfig?

程序開發過程中往往很多參數需要放在配置文件中,因爲這樣可以避免更改代碼重新編譯的問題。
通常我們可以通過自己讀init文件來實現,不過已經有很多人做了這方面的東西,可以借用,Libconfig就是其中之一。
Libconfig是用來讀寫,控制配置文件的一個庫,目前支持C和C++兩種語言,方便好用,可以一試。

二:怎麼使用?

1. 下載

2. 解壓後執行
./configure

make

make install

3. 使用可以參考examples

4. 編譯時加上 -lconfig++ 或者-lconfig 選項

三:會遇到的問題及注意事項

錯誤:
Error while loading shared library: libconfig++.so.9
解決方式
執行:sudo ldconfig -v
往/lib和/usr/lib裏面加東西,不用修改/etc/ld.so.conf,但要調一下ldconfig,否則可能這個library會找不到


參考:


發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章